About Nanomoles per hour
The nanomole per hour (nmol/h) equals 10⁻⁹/3600 ≈ 2.778×10⁻¹³ mol/s, used in membrane transport kinetics, stable-isotope tracer pharmacokinetics, and slow enzymatic reactions in isolated cells. Urea cycle flux in isolated hepatocytes and copper transport across intestinal epithelia are typically measured in nmol/h per mg protein. 1 nmol/h ≈ 2.778×10⁻¹³ mol/s.
About Kilomoles per minute
The kilomole per minute (kmol/min) equals 1000/60 ≈ 16.667 mol/s, an intermediate unit used when converting kmol/h datasheets to per-second rates in dynamic process simulations. Control engineers working with fast-responding reactors and pipeline compressor station models use kmol/min for transient mass-balance calculations. 1 kmol/min ≈ 16.667 mol/s = 60 kmol/h.
